Ronald Hemi

Ronald Courtney Hemi (15 May 1933 – 13 September 2000) was a New Zealand rugby union footballer.

He played 46 matches for the All Blacks including 16 tests from 1953 to 1959.

He also played first-class cricket for Auckland.
